What is tallow and why do you use it in skincare?

Tallow is rendered beef fat with a fatty acid profile similar to human sebum. We source ours from regeneratively raised cattle, which exceeds grass-fed and organic standards for soil health and animal welfare.

Is tallow rich in vitamins A, D, E, and K?

No, and we would rather say so plainly. Those vitamins are fat-soluble, so people assume a fat must be full of them. Independent lab testing of grass-fed tallow found only trace amounts, far below a dose that does anything on skin. That is why our formula adds rosehip and sea buckthorn for vitamin A and omega-7 instead of relying on the tallow.

Will tallow clog my pores?

What usually breaks people out is what the tallow is blended with, not the tallow. In a controlled trial, four weeks of topical olive oil reduced skin barrier integrity. Coconut oil is highly comedogenic and essential oils are a common sensitizer. Our formula leaves all three out. Any rich balm can still be too heavy for very oily skin.

Is your product essential oil free?

Yes. Every True Origin product contains zero essential oils. Scent comes from slow infusion of whole botanicals directly into the lipid base, which makes it appropriate for pregnancy, postpartum, breastfeeding, and reactive skin.

What is suet-based tallow and why does it matter?

Suet is the fat surrounding the kidneys and organs. Most competitors use trim fat from other parts. Suet produces a purer, odorless tallow with a more neutral base, so we avoid needing essential oils to mask odor.

How to Use

How do I apply Deep Hydration Whip?

Use a pea-sized amount on damp skin after cleansing or bathing. Press gently into your face, neck, or body. Damp skin helps the lipid spread and absorb.

How do I use it on my face vs. my body?

On the face, apply after cleansing to damp skin with gentle pressing, then wait about 60 seconds before sunscreen or makeup. On the body, apply post-shower to damp skin. Same product, both areas.

Can I use it around my eyes?

Yes. With no essential oils or actives, the eye area is fine. Use a small amount and pat rather than rub.

Can I use it with retinol or other actives?

Yes. Standard layering: water-based serum first, then your active such as retinol or tretinoin, then Deep Hydration Whip as the final occlusive layer to seal everything in.

Do I still need a separate moisturizer?

For most users, no. It replaces face moisturizer, body moisturizer, hand cream, and lip balm, with a separate sunscreen.

Texture & Storage

Why does the texture vary between jars?

We use no synthetic stabilizers, so each batch reflects natural variation in the tallow and botanicals. Performance is consistent. The exact look may shift slightly.

What if my jar arrives soft or melted?

The product is unaffected. Refrigerate for 30 minutes and rewhip gently with a clean utensil to restore the texture.

Are small specks normal?

Yes. They are from the botanical infusions of rose petals, vanilla pods, and marshmallow root, and do not affect performance.

What is the shelf life?

12 months unopened. Use within 6 months once opened.
